Graves' Orbitopathy (GO) is an autoimmune disease that involves orbital tissues, leading to temporary or permanent damage to the eye. Although GO is a rare condition, it negatively affects the quality of life in the majority of patients. In the majority of european centers, high-dose intravenous glucocorticoid (GCs) therapy remains the first-line treatment in patients with active, moderate-to-severe GO. However, GCs are effective in only 45-60% of patients, with a high probability of diseases relapse (10-40%) or disease progression to dysthyroid optic neuropathy (up to 10%). Due to limited efficacy of GCs, unpredictable relapses and progression of GO, the management of GO remains a challenge.
A few studies have demonstrated that interleukin-6 (IL-6) blockade with tocilizumab (TCZ) is effective in GC-refractory GO. However, the long-term outcomes of TCZ remain scarce.
Therefore, the investigators are planning to assess the therapy with Tocilizumab, regarding clinical outcomes and adverse events. The investigators plan to include a total of 30 patients with active, moderate-to-severe, corticosteroid-resistant GO over a period of approximately 4 years.

Improvement of quality of life according to the disease-specific quality of life questionnaire in Graves' orbitopathy (GO-QoL) at 16, 24 and 48 weeks. All Go-QoL questions will be scored as 'severely limited' (one point), a 'little limited' (two points), or 'not limited at all' (three points). The questions will be transformed from 0 to 100 by the following formula: total score= (raw score- 8)/16 x100. An improvement in QoL wil be considered, if there will be an increase of 6 or more points on either one (or both) the GO-QoL scales (functioning and appearance);
